Princeton's WordNet
cowberry, mountain cranberry, lingonberry, lingenberry, lingberry, foxberry, Vaccinium vitis-idaeanoun
low evergreen shrub of high north temperate regions of Europe and Asia and America bearing red edible berries

Wikipedia
foxberry
Vaccinium vitis-idaea, the lingonberry, partridgeberry, mountain cranberry or cowberry, is a small evergreen shrub in the heath family Ericaceae, that bears edible fruit. It is native to boreal forest and Arctic tundra throughout the Northern Hemisphere, from Europe and Asia to North America. Lingonberries are picked in the wild and used to accompany a variety of dishes in Northern Baltoscandia, Russia, Canada and Alaska. Commercial cultivation is undertaken in the U.S. Pacific Northwest and in many other regions of the world.

foxberry
Foxberry, also known as lingonberry or cowberry, is a small, evergreen shrub that produces edible fruit. It is found mainly in the Northern Hemisphere in arctic and subarctic regions and in boreal forests. The berries are small, red and tart, often used in jams, syrups and baked goods.
